    These look like finesse baits for bass, but the idea will be good as long as the price doesn't make them too high! I don't think they will last longer than just the soft plastics, but I have not used one either so not sure. I think anything you can add hair or feathers to it will add action.

    Zell Rowland (bass fisherman) got famous by sanding down the old Pop-R baits and then painting them and adding some Hackle tail in place of the synthetic material tails.

    I know they mold there's in but if you take a large eyed needle or even some wire you can pull hair into plastics and make your own.
